Kitbull reviews
"Kitbull" is a no dialogue animated short film directed by Rosana Sullivan. It tells the heart-warming story of the friendship between a stray cat and a bulldog. The film was released in the United States on February 18, 2019.

The Lord of the Rings reviews
The Lord of the Rings is an animated film directed by Ralph Bakshi . Based on J.R.R. Tolkien's classic fantasy epic "The Lord of the Rings" , plots include "The Lord of the Rings" and "Two Cities" the first half of . Set in Middle-earth , the story revolves around the Fellowship of the Ring formed by Hobbits , Elves , humans, Dwarf, and wizards. They set out on a journey to destroy the one ring forged by the Dark Lord Sauron , and to ensure that Sauron's conspiracy does not succeed .

Only Yesterday reviews
"The Fairy Tale of Time" is a Japanese animation film directed by Takahata Isao and dubbed by IMAI MIKI and Honna Yōko , produced byスタジオジブリ. The film tells the story of Taeko gradually getting to know herself and her life during a ten-day country holiday, and thus found her lover and changed her life . The film was released in Japan on July 20, 1991. In 1992, won the 15th Japan's アカデミー Award Topics Award - the most topical film award.
